Describe the contraction and Peacefulness of Cardiac Fibres

Describe the contraction and Peacefulness of Cardiac Fibres

The human heart is seen as a muscular body organ that pumping systems blood flow through the circulatory platform by way of the bloodstream. The move of blood within the circulatory method is important in the shipping of much needed oxygen and nourishing substances towards shape skin cells and the removal of metabolic trash from physical structure areas. The septa divides the heart into 4 chambers called the right and left atria, that are the upper two compartments and then the left and right ventricles, the lower compartments. The moment the ventricles unwind, they collect our blood in the event the atria plan. The ventricles then contract to push bloodstream in the arteries and out of the coronary heart. The atria loosen up to acquire blood vessels with the blood vessels and contract to operate a vehicle your blood directly into the ventricles. This list of peacefulness and contraction of a cardiac muscle, otherwise known as the cardiac cycle, methods the pulse rate (Martini, Timmons Andamp; Tallitsch, 2012).

The pericardium can be described as shielding sac that encloses the center to shield it plus sustain its situation in your thorax. The retaining wall with the cardiovascular is split into a trio of tiers that can be different in size. These are definitely endocardium internally, myocardium in between and epicardium externally. Cardiac muscle tissue create in the cardiomyocytes characterized by striations (sorted out plan of myofibrils and myofilaments) and T-tubules that transfer signals into the indoor for this tissues. The contractile tissues of this cardiac muscles are responsible for the pumping on the heart but can not trigger the job alone. At least one the remaining hands, autorythmic cells trigger and regulate the contraction of this contractile skin cells. The autorythmic microscopic cells are found in the sinoatrial node (SA node), atrioventricular node, the atrioventricular pack (package of His) plus the Purkinje materials. These tissues have a number of estimates of depolarization and providing motions prospective. The SA node manufactures the easiest pace of steps possibility (Sherwood, 2012).

Systole is the duration should the coronary heart commitments to water pump bloodstream as diastole is when the center your muscles plan to satisfy the ventricles in addition to the atria with bloodstream. The contraction and leisure of cardiac body soluble fiber is coordinated by stressed muscle tissues. Contraction belongs to the most explicit assets of this cardiac muscle tissue. This approach is advanced and depends upon interaction somewhere between calcium ions, contractile proteins, power phosphates (adenosine triphosphate, ATP, and keratin phosphate, KP) and calcium supplements cell vehicles techniques. The sinoatrial node delivers the motions ability which distributes for a speed of 1.2 m/s through the operational syncytium and it is done from mobile to mobile phone. Within the stimulated mobile phone, the actions probable factors up-to-date circulate and polarizes the adjacent cell phone. This leads to the atrial systole for the reason that mechanized responses (Martini, Timmons Andamp; Tallitsch, 2012).

Conduction of impulse belonging to the atrium towards ventricle is stopped by connective tissue cells along with the valvular parts throughout the atrioventricular groove. This gives to the your blood to flow through the atrium with the ventricle. The atrioventricular node which performs the impulse in the smaller speeds around .1 m/s then propagates the electrical related impulse on the package of His which conducts the impulse in the performance of 1.2 to 2 m/s. The impulse goes by throughout the accurate and then the rendered divisions of this pack and quickly distributes by means of the Purkinje roughage with the cardiac muscle tissue tissues to build ventricular contraction. This results in flow of blood right out of the ventricles within the arteries (Sherwood, 2012).

Calcium mineral ions (Ca2 ) lay within the T tubules from the cardiac body which open up on an move promising. The ions diffuse on the cytosol and reasons launch of calcium supplement ion from adjoining sarcoplasmic reticulum sacs in this way raising the Ca2 around the cytosol. This in turn stimulates the contraction procedure of the center your muscles through the impulse. At the same time, the removal of the Ca2 by mechanisms at the sarcoplasmic reticulum and plasma membrane layer on the cytosol results in the center muscular tissues to unwind. This happens when the power impulse fades as well as relaxing associated with the cardiac muscle tissues starts. The relief in the cardiac muscle is going to be diastole stage about the cardiac phase (Sherwood, 2012).

Through the entire life of a human being, the cardiac muscular tissues rhythmically acquire and de-stress ensuring a stable bloodstream circulation of your blood in your body. Systole or contraction improves the tension of body as you are diastole which is rest reduces the blood pressure levels.
